    It's probably not a great idea. I haven't heard of this brand but the really cheap eBay racers tend to get less than glowing reviews. Having said that the actual spec on that bike is reasonable for the price.

    At the same time, I'd consider something like this (with the free delivery, won't cost that much more) or even better, try to pick an entry-level racer up second-hand (likes of the Trek 1000, Specialized Allez, Giant SCR, etc.)
